(Photos) Ebony Magazine Dedicates Four Separate Covers To Trayvon Martin

Ebony Magazine dedicated its September issue to Trayvon Martin, and will publish four separate covers in his honor. In addition to Trayvon Martin’s parents donning a hoodie on the cover, the three other covers will feature Dwayne Wade, Boris Kodjoe and Spike Lee and their sons. Kicks: Guess Which Jordan Style Is Re-Releasing Again After A Longggg Time? Hint…Think Teenage Jordan Days!

I need these in my Summer wardrobe man, but I’ll have to settle and wait till November. Jordan brand is bringing back the Jordan V “Laney” this winter. The the royal/yellow colorway is based on Michael Jordan’s highschool, the Emsley A. Laney High School in Wilmington, North Carolina. These may be one of my favorite retros of 2013. No More Chris Brown After His Sixth Album?!

The media has definitely gotten under Chris Brown’s skin. The frustrated singer has announced that he’s actually considering retiring from the music game after his sixth studio album X album releases later this summer. Taking to his Twitter in a rant this morning, he told “mainstream America” not to worry, because after this album, it would likely be his last. As I mentioned earlier, he seems pretty frustrated that people are still holding his incident with Rihanna over his head, and he just can’t seem to take much more of it.
